1. Breakthrough in Battery-Swapping Electric Motorbike Rentals at Key Tourist Hubs

Over the past 24 hours, electric motorbike rental services using next-generation battery-swapping technology in Da Nang have recorded exponential growth. Rental providers have deployed automated battery-swapping networks across coastal routes like Vo Nguyen Giap and Pham Van Dong, as well as major tourist spots such as Linh Ung Pagoda (Son Tra). Tourists now spend only 2 minutes swapping for a fully charged battery instead of waiting 3-4 hours to recharge. Battery-swapping e-motorbikes are rapidly becoming the top choice for FIT (Free Independent Travelers) visiting the coastal city.

3. Strategic Partnership Between Da Nang Department of Tourism and E-Motorbike Rental Platforms

Da Nang's tourism sector officially launched the 'Zero-Emission Green Tourism' campaign in direct collaboration with local electric motorbike rental enterprises. Under the agreement, over 1,000 eco-friendly electric motorbikes have been deployed to serve heritage exploration routes, Hai Van Pass, and the Son Tra Peninsula. The project ensures continuous charging and battery-swapping station infrastructure along all primary tourist routes across the city.

5. Shift in Transportation Trends Among Korean Tourists in Da Nang

The latest statistics released today show that Korean tourists—Da Nang's largest international market—are significantly changing their transportation habits. Over 45% of independent Korean travelers now choose self-drive electric motorbike rentals over traditional taxis. The primary drivers are the convenience of the battery-swapping ecosystem, cost savings of over 40% compared to gasoline vehicles, and the ability to flexibly explore local culture in an eco-friendly manner.
